Transaction 8513214769f992b23d3060acfbce715519e3aee76e9da496c199581bcdb8dce4

2 Input
2 Outputs
  • 8513214769f992b23d3060acfbce715519e3aee76e9da496c199581bcdb8dce4:0
  • value  20736
    address  1GuGXGQ532ZFwtxiojVroLsBqNqYBnLzZY
  • 8513214769f992b23d3060acfbce715519e3aee76e9da496c199581bcdb8dce4:1
  • value  381280
    address  3FQCfq2NgDsSKcB8dp7WNE8aFcPC8kDRkk